## Formula sandbox tuning

User-supplied formulas in Gridmoor execute inside a restricted interpreter with hard ceilings on time, memory, and call depth. Reviewers should confirm any change to these ceilings is justified in the PR description, since raising them widens the abuse surface. Defaults were chosen from production traces. The current limits are as follows.

limits module of tafog-fawip:
WEIGHTS = {
    "julix": 57,
    "lamys": 992,
    "kasvan": 209,
    "quenok": 750,
    "alddor": 259,
    "oliath": 1009,
    "wenix": 815,
}

**Q: My rebalancing plugin for Spokeshift can't write to the depot ledger — help?**

A: Happens a lot! Plugin sandboxes get read-only ledger access by default, so your truck-routing suggestions land in the proposals queue instead of committing directly. That's intentional — a dispatcher approves them. If you're testing locally with the dev harness, you can unlock full ledger writes by opening the sandbox's sealed test vault. The recovery passphrase for that vault is below.

strongbox words: zorwyn-sorael-belion-ulaius-silmir-ulays-briax-rusdor-gorix

Subject: Planner cut-over done

Team — the Quillbase query planner cut-over finished last night. The regression that caused full scans on joined lookups is fixed by forcing the v2 cost model; v1 is disabled, not removed. If customers report slow reports, confirm they're on the Marrowfield cluster before escalating. Rollback window closes Friday. The planner is now running with the following configuration.

deployment values, yadup-kadug:
[sorys]
port = 5672
team = noveth
host = sorys.orvexcorp.example
region = south-4
access_code = ac_deddc1
timeout_ms = 1500

## Partner SFTP Drop — Marlowe Freight

Files land nightly between 02:00–03:30 UTC in the inbound drop. Watcher job `marlowe-ingest` picks them up; if nothing arrives by 04:00, the Quillhook alert fires. Do NOT re-request files from Marlowe before checking the quarantine folder — malformed headers get parked there silently. Retries are safe; ingest is idempotent on file checksum. Rotation of the drop credentials is quarterly, owned by platform. Full escalation steps and contacts are on the runbook page.

dashboard of taduf-tahof = https://confluence.tolvaqlabs.internal/browse/browse/display/f01240ca